Web Chat API as React hooks

Web Chat is designed to be highly customizable. In order to build your own UI, you can use React Hooks to hook your UI component into Web Chat API.

To enable Web Chat API, all UI components must be located under the <Composer> component. You can refer to our plain UI customization sample for details.

Why React Hooks

React Hooks will make your code cleaner and shorter, and also greatly improve readability.

Web Chat exposes APIs through React Hooks. This API surface enables us to freely move things behind the scene, introduce new APIs, and safely deprecate APIs. It will also make it easier to shuffle work between the internal Redux store and React Context.

Two types of hooks

We design our hooks largely with two basic shapes:

  • Actions, these are functions that you can call at any time to perform a side-effect
  • Properties, these are getter functions with an optional setter
    • This is same as React State Hook pattern, but setters are optional
    • If the value is changed, React will call your render function again

Actions

All actions will return a function that can be called at a later point. For example, if you want to focus to the send box, you will use the following code:

const focus = useFocus();

focus('sendBox');

Properties

All properties follow React State Hook pattern. For example, if you want to get and set the value of send box, you will use the following code:

const [sendBoxValue, setSendBoxValue] = useSendBoxValue();

console.log(`The send box value is "${sendBoxValue}".`);

setSendBoxValue('Hello, World!');

Note: some properties may not be settable.

useActiveTyping

interface Typing {
  at: number;
  expireAt: number;
  name: string;
  role: 'bot' | 'user';
  type: 'busy' | 'livestream';
}

useActiveTyping(expireAfter?: number): readonly [Readonly<Record<string, Typing>>]

On or before 4.15.1, there is an issue which the at field is not accurately reflecting the time when the participant start typing.

New in 4.18.0: Added type property. The returned type is marked as read-only to prevent accidental modification.

This hook will return a list of participants who are actively typing, including the start typing time (at) and expiration time (expireAt), the name and the role of the participant. Both time values are based on local clock.

If the participant sends a message after the typing activity, the participant will be explicitly removed from the list. If no messages or typing activities are received, the participant is considered inactive and not listed in the result. To keep the typing indicator active, participants should continuously send the typing activity.

The expireAfter argument can override the inactivity timer. If expireAfter is Infinity, it will return all participants who did not explicitly remove from the list. In other words, it will return participants who sent a typing activity, but did not send a message activity afterward.

The type property will tell if the participant is livestreaming or busy preparing its response:

  • busy indicates the participant is busy preparing the response
  • livestream indicates the participant is sending its response as it is being prepared

This hook will trigger render of your component if one or more typing information is expired or removed.

useConnectivityStatus

useConnectivityStatus(): [string]

This hook will return the Direct Line connectivity status:

  • connected: Connected
  • connectingslow: Connecting is incomplete and more than 15 seconds have passed
  • error: Connection error
  • notconnected: Not connected, related to invalid credentials
  • reconnected: Reconnected after interruption
  • reconnecting: Reconnecting after interruption
  • sagaerror: Errors on JavaScript renderer; please see the browser's console
  • uninitialized: Initial connectivity state; never connected and not attempting to connect.

useCreateActivityRenderer

useCreateActivityRenderer(): ({
  activity: Activity
}) =>
  (
    false |
    ({
      hideTimestamp: boolean,
      renderActivityStatus: false | () => React.Element,
      renderAvatar: false | () => React.Element,
      showCallout: boolean
    }) => React.Element
  )

This hook will return a function that, when called, will return a function to render the specified activity.

If a render function is returned, calling the function must return visualization of the activity. The visualization may vary based on the activity status, avatar, and bubble nub (a.k.a. callout).

If the activity middleware wants to hide the activity, it must return false instead of a render function. The middleware should not return a render function that, when called, will return false.

For renderActivityStatus and renderAvatar, it could be one of the followings:

  • false: Do not render activity status or avatar.
  • () => React.Element: Render activity status or avatar by calling this function.

If showCallout is truthy, the activity should render the bubble nub and an avatar. The activity should call useStyleOptions to get the styling for the bubble nub, including but not limited to: fill and outline color, offset from top/bottom, size.

If showCallout is falsy but renderAvatar is truthy, the activity should not render the avatar, but leave a space for the avatar to keep aligned with other activities.

useDictateAbortable

useDictateAbortable(): [boolean]

When called, this hook will return true if the current dictation is abortable, otherwise, false.

useDictateInterims

useDictateInterims(): [string[][]]

This hook will return active interims processed from a dictation event.

The first array represents separate sentences while the second array represents potential ambiguities or alternatives for the same sentence.

useDictateState

useDictateState(): [string]

This hook will return one of the following dictation states:

  • IDLE: Recognition engine is idle; not recognizing
  • WILL_START: Will start recognition after synthesis completed
  • STARTING: Recognition engine is starting; not accepting any inputs
  • DICTATING: Recognition engine is accepting input
  • STOPPING: Recognition engine is stopping; not accepting any inputs

Please refer to Constants.DictateState in botframework-webchat-core for up-to-date details.

To control dictate state, use the useStartDictate and useStopDictate hooks.

useDirection

useDirection(): [string]

This hook will return one of two language directions:

  • ltr or otherwise: Web Chat UI will display as left-to-right
  • rtl: Web Chat UI will display as right-to-left

This value will be automatically configured based on the locale of Web Chat.

If you would prefer to set this property manually, change the value dir prop passed to Web Chat.

useGrammars

useGrammars(): [string[]]

This hook will return grammars for speech-to-text. Grammars is a list of words provided by the implementer for the speech-to-text engine to bias towards. It is commonly used for selecting the correct words with same or similar pronunciations, e.g. Bellevue vs. Bellview vs. Bellvue.

To modify this value, change the value in the style options prop passed to Web Chat.

useGroupTimestamp

useGroupTimestamp(): [number]

This hook will return the interval for grouping similar activities with a single timestamp. The interval is represented in milliseconds.

For example, if this value is 5000, successive activities within 5 seconds will share the timestamp of the first message.

To control the groupTimestamp state, change the props passed to Web Chat via style options.

useLanguage

type LanguageOptions = 'speech';

useLanguage(options?: LanguageOptions): [string]

This hook will return the language of the UI. All UI components should honor this value.

If no options are passed, the return value will be the written language. This value should be the same as props.locale passed to <ReactWebChat> or <Composer>.

If "speech" is passed to options, the return value will be the oral language instead of written language. For example, the written language for Hong Kong SAR and Taiwan are Traditional Chinese, while the oral language are Cantonese and Taiwanese Mandarin respectively.

To modify this value, change the value in the locale prop passed to Web Chat.

Plural form

interface PluralRulesIdentifier {
  zero?: string,
  one?: string,
  two?: string,
  few?: string,
  many?: string,
  other: string
}

useLocalizer({ plural: true }) => (identifiers: PluralRulesIdentifier, firstArgument: number, ...otherArguments: string[]) => string

Some localized strings may contains words that have multiple plural forms, for example, "1 notification" and "2 notifications".

Web Chat supports multiple plural forms based on Unicode Plural Rules. For a single string, you will need to specify up to 6 strings (zero, one, two, few, many, other). You must at least specify string that represent the "other" plural rule.

The first argument must be a number and used to select which plural form to use. Only cardinal is supported at this time.

const localize = useLocalize({ plural: true });

// The following code will print "2 notifications" to console.

console.log(
   localize(
      {
         zero: 'No notifications',
         one: 'A notification',
         two: '$1 notifications',
         few: '$1 notifications',
         many: '$1 notifications',
         other: '$1 notifications'
      },
      2
   )
);

useObserveScrollPosition

useObserveScrollPosition(observer: (ScrollObserver? | false), deps: any[]): void

type ScrollObserver = (position: ScrollPosition) => void;

type ScrollPosition {
  activityID: string;
  scrollTop: number;
}

This function accept an observer function. When the scroll position has changed, the observer function will be called with the latest ScrollPosition.

The position argument can be passed to useScrollTo hook to restore scroll position.

Since the observer function will be called rapidly, please keep the code in the function as lightweight as possible.

To stop observing scroll positions, pass a falsy value to the observer argument.

If there is more than one transcripts, scrolling any of them will trigger the observer function, and there is no clear distinction of which transcript is being scrolled.

useSendStatusByActivityKey

useSendStatusByActivityKey(): [Map<string, 'sending' | 'send failed' | 'sent'>]

This hook will return send status of all outgoing activities, either "sending", "send failed", or "sent". The key of the Map is activity key. This is different than activity ID and can be obtained via the useGetKeyByActivity or useGetKeyByActivityId hooks.

"send failed" is not a terminator state. An activity marked as "send failed" could become other state again. However, "sent" is a terminator state.

If styleOptions.sendTimeout or styleOptions.sendTimeoutForAttachments increased, an activity previously marked as "send failed" (due to timeout) could become "sending" again.

If the activity failed to send ("send failed"), retrying the send will also change the send status back to "sending".

Send status is based on clock and could change very frequently. This will incur performance cost. Please use this hook deliberately.

useShouldReduceMotion

Only available on botframework-webchat-components package.

New in 4.19.0.

useShouldReduceMotion(): readonly [boolean]

This state hook is a helper hook that will return true if the browser has reduced motion enabled, otherwise, false.

This hook is based on matchMedia and provides a React hook friendly wrapper for listening to state change.

If it is possible to slowdown or pause animation using CSS, always use the CSS media feature (prefers-reduced-motion: reduce) instead. This hook is the last resort when CSS cannot be used to stop animation, such as SMIL animation.

useTrackTiming

useTrackTiming(): (name: string, fn: function) => void
useTrackTiming(): (name: string, promise: Promise) => void

This function will emit timing measurements for the execution of a synchronous or asynchronous function. Before the execution, the onTelemetry handler will be triggered with a timingstart event. After completion, regardless of resolve or reject, the onTelemetry handler will be triggered again with a timingend event.

If the function throws an exception while executing, the exception will be reported to useTrackException hook as a non-fatal error.

What is activity key?

Activity ID is a service-assigned ID that is unique in the conversation. However, not every activity has an activity ID. Therefore, it is not possible to reference every activities in the chat history by solely using activity ID.

Web Chat introduces activity key as an alternative method to reference activity in the system.

Activity key is an opaque string. When the activity first appear in Web Chat, they will be assigned an activity key and never be reassigned to another key again until Web Chat is restarted.

Multiple activities could share the same activity key if they are revision of each others. For example, a livestreaming activity could made up of different revisions of the same activity. Thus, these activities would share the same activity key.

Following hooks are designed to help navigating between activity, activity ID and activity keys:

What is acknowledged activity?

Chat history normally would scroll to the bottom when message arrive and remains stick to the bottom. However, in some circumstances, such as the bot sending more than a page of message, the chat history will pause the auto-scroll and unstick from the bottom.

The pause helps users to read the long text sent by the bot without explicitly scrolling up from the very bottom of the chat history.

Activities are being acknowledged when the chat history view is being scroll to the end, either by auto-scroll or manually after a pause. It can also be programmatically acknowledged using the useMarkAllAsAcknowledged hook.
